How much does a golf cart cost in the UAE?

How much does a golf cart cost in the UAE?

From entry golf carts to premium four-seaters, here are indicative UAE golf cart prices in AED, plus the running costs that decide what a cart really costs to own.

Hawke Editorial Team·June 17, 2026·7 min read

Golf cart prices in the UAE span a wide range, from modest two-seaters to fully specified premium machines that rival a small car. The headline figure is only part of the story, because the battery, the build quality and the local support quietly determine what the cart really costs over the years you own it. This guide gives indicative AED ranges and then explains the costs behind them.

Why lithium changes the maths

A lithium pack usually adds to the purchase price but earns it back in the Gulf. It tolerates extreme heat, holds charge through long storage, lasts more cycles and needs far less maintenance than lead-acid. In a climate where golf carts sit through 45C summers, that durability is not a luxury; it is the difference between a cart that lasts and one that needs an expensive pack replacement in a few years.

The running costs people forget

A cart is cheap to run compared with a car, but it is not free. Budgeting for these keeps ownership pleasant.

  • Electricity to charge, which is modest given the small battery relative to a car.
  • Tyres, which wear faster on sand, gravel and hot tarmac.
  • Brake and general servicing to keep the community safety check easy to pass.
  • Battery replacement eventually, the single biggest line item, far cheaper to defer with lithium.
  • Any community registration or third-party liability cover your community requests.

What drives the final price

Beyond the band, several choices nudge the figure. Seating count, battery capacity and range, premium upholstery and finishes, a hardtop or weather protection, upgraded tires, and accessories like cargo beds or lighting all add up. Decide what you genuinely need before adding extras, since a focused spec is both cheaper and easier to live with.

Weather protection deserves a special mention in the UAE. A roof and, in some cases, removable doors or a fan transform how usable a cart is for nine months of the year. They cost more upfront, but for daily summer use they are closer to essential than optional. Likewise, paying for a slightly larger battery than your minimum need is rarely wasted money, because it reduces how hard the pack works in the heat and extends its life.

Total cost of ownership, not just the sticker

The most useful way to think about price is over the whole time you will own the cart. A cheaper cart with a weak battery and no local support can cost more within three years than a dearer one that simply works. Factor in the likely battery replacement, the ease of getting parts, and the resale value at the end. Viewed this way, the premium for a well-supported, climate-ready cart often turns out to be the economical choice rather than the extravagant one.

Where the money is well spent

If you are deciding where to allocate a fixed budget, three areas reward the spend most in the UAE. The battery comes first, because it is the heart of the cart and the costliest thing to get wrong. Build quality and climate protection come second, since they decide whether the cart survives the heat, dust and, near the coast, salt. Local support comes third, because parts and service availability quietly determine your experience for years. Trim, color and cosmetic extras are pleasant but should never come at the expense of those three fundamentals.

Frequently asked questions

How much does a golf cart cost in the UAE?+

Indicatively, entry golf carts start from around AED 28,000 to 45,000, four-seaters from AED 40,000 to 70,000, and premium models from AED 70,000 to 130,000 plus. Used golf carts run from around AED 15,000 to 35,000.

Why are some golf carts so much more expensive?+

Higher prices reflect more seating, a better and larger battery, superior build quality, longer range, premium finishes and proper local warranty and support.

Is a lithium cart worth the extra cost?+

In the UAE climate, usually yes. Lithium tolerates extreme heat, holds charge in storage, lasts more cycles and needs less maintenance, lowering the lifetime cost.

What does it cost to run a golf cart?+

Running costs are low: modest electricity, periodic tires and servicing, and eventual battery replacement. Lithium packs push that biggest cost much further into the future.
